About Joshua Kahan

Joshua Kahan is a scholar working on Neurology, Cognitive Neuroscience and Cellular and Molecular Neuroscience, having authored 26 papers that have together received 2.0k indexed citations. Recurring topics across this work include Neurological disorders and treatments (12 papers), Functional Brain Connectivity Studies (9 papers) and Parkinson's Disease Mechanisms and Treatments (7 papers). The work is most often cited by research in Neurology (876 citations), Cognitive Neuroscience (974 citations) and Cellular and Molecular Neuroscience (463 citations). Joshua Kahan has collaborated with scholars based in United Kingdom, United States and Germany. Frequent co-authors include Karl Friston, Adeel Razi, Thomas Foltynie, Bharat B. Biswal, Patricia Limousin, Ludvic Zrinzo, Geraint Rees, Marwan Hariz, Laura Mancini and John S. Thornton. Their work appears in journals such as PLoS ONE, NeuroImage and Brain.
